we have just come back from a long weekend on Dalesbridge site  near Austwick , Settle - the outside temp. on Saturday morn at 0830 was -7 degrees, cold enough to freeze the internal pipes to kitchen and shower but not the bathroom sink even with the electric heater on, they thawed out by 1400 hrs, I didn,t check the onboard tank as I was rushing off to do Ingleborough but the spare carrriers outside were frozen up until Sunday
